Over the past few years, the swimming training movement has flourished in Hanoi, particularly in Hoang Mai District. Annually, the city organizes numerous competitions for all age groups to foster a swimming culture, encouraging people to regularly learn and train in swimming for health enhancement.

Participating in the Hanoi City Middle and Senior Age Swimming Championship 2023, held from July 12 to July 14, 2023, the delegation of athletes from Hoang Mai District splendidly secured 3 gold medals, 1 silver medal, and 2 bronze medals.

This annual competition serves as a wholesome and beneficial sporting event, especially for individuals in the middle and senior age groups. The championship acts as a platform to assess, discover, and select outstanding athletes to represent Hanoi in the National Traditional Swimming Competition for the middle and senior age groups.

This year’s Swimming Championship is organized to align with the campaign ‘The Entire Population Enhances Physical Fitness Following the Exemplary Great Uncle Ho,’ promoting awareness of the benefits of swimming training, emphasizing safety skills in aquatic environments, and contributing to building a healthy lifestyle of ‘living joyfully, living healthily, living meaningfully’ for middle and senior-aged individuals.

Athletes participating in the championship.

This year, the competition attracted more than 120 athletes aged from 35 to 70, representing 14 districts, towns, and townships across the city of Hanoi. Athletes competed in various events, including Freestyle (50m, 100m, 200m), Backstroke (50m, 100m), Breaststroke (50m, 100m, 200m), and Butterfly (50m). The Hoang Mai District team, with 6 registered athletes, unfortunately, had 2 athletes unable to participate due to health conditions just before the opening ceremony. Despite having only 4 competing athletes, they showcased dedication, professional competence, and a competitive spirit, excellently bringing home 3 gold medals in events such as Men’s 50m Butterfly, Men’s Freestyle, and Men’s 100m Breaststroke for the age group of 40-44; 1 silver medal in Men’s 100m Freestyle; and 2 bronze medals in Men’s 50m Freestyle and Men’s 100m Breaststroke for the age group of 45-49. At the end of the competition, the Organizing Committee awarded a total of 51 sets of medals to athletes in each competition category.
